The effectiveness or "best" form of government depends on various factors, including the context, values, and goals of a society. Democratic governments prioritize representation, individual rights, and participation of the people in decision-making processes. They aim for accountability through free and fair elections, fostering stability and providing a platform for diverse voices.

Military governments, on the other hand, are characterized by rule by the armed forces. They might prioritize stability, order, and security but often limit civil liberties and suppress political opposition. 

Generally, democratic governments are favored for their emphasis on freedom, accountability, and inclusivity. However, each type has its strengths and weaknesses, and what's considered "best" can vary based on the needs and circumstances of a nation.
